WebbSince its publication in France in the first quarter of the twentieth century, this vast novel has never been out of print. Known for many years in English as Remembrance of Things Past, the title chosen by its distinguished translator C.K. Scott-Moncrieff, this work continues to delight readers in more than thirty languages throughout the world.
